The 1950 Census and Family History Training

The 1950 Census is coming out next month! Join us for Family History Training on Zoom.

Elder and Sister Perkins, who are missionaries in The Senior Service Missionaries in Family Search Texas Mission, will give us insights and things to watch for. In this census we can begin to see the effect the end of WWII had on our country as returning soldiers marry, start families (beginning the baby boom!), take advantage of the VA Bill of Rights for continued education, buy houses, etc. We’ll be able to find records of relatives we have known in our lifetime—grandparents, parents.
